Associate Distribution Engineer

Remote Full-time
Leidos is seeking Associate Distribution Engineers & Designers who are passionate about electric utility design engineering. This role involves supporting the development of design and construction work packages for electrical distribution systems and ensuring compliance with engineering standards. Responsibilities Support the development of design and construction work packages for electrical overhead and underground distribution systems for electric utility customers Assist in reviewing client-provided work and help interpret scope requirements under guidance from senior team members Perform basic engineering calculations such as pole loading, guying, conductor sag and tension, and voltage drop with oversight Provide support during construction activities, including assisting with post-construction reviews to help ensure compliance with engineering and construction standards Assist with analysis of outages and contribute to mitigation efforts using established engineering practices Gain experience coordinating with other utilities and field engineering requirements, supporting design efforts for cable/conduit projects, and assisting with permitting, easements, and right-of-way (ROW) documentation Skills Ability to utilize a personal vehicle, as some customer-related travel could be anticipated (Job-related travel will be reimbursed at IRS-approved rates) Willingness to perform both field and office work Ability to work in outdoor environments on occasion The role may require customer-site visits to collect field data that will assist in developing work packages Candidates should possess valid U.S. driver's license, as some local or regional travel is expected Bachelor's Degree (Electrical, Mechanical, Civil, or Industrial preferred); additional relevant experience/certifications may be considered in lieu of bachelor's degree Ability to demonstrate proficiency with the NESC Benefits Competitive compensation Health and Wellness programs Income Protection Paid Leave Retirement Company Overview Leidos is an industry and technology leader serving government and commercial customers with smarter, more efficient digital and mission innovations.
